A woman died in a house fire Friday night in Washington, according to authorities in Washington County.
Karen Elizabeth Campbell, 75, was found in the home on Central Avenue near the intersection with Poplar Street, according to the Washington Fire Department.
Firefighters responded to the home shortly before 9:30 p.m. and had to fight their way in through intense fire conditions, said Gene Mercer, acting captain for the department.
Ms. Campbell was found on an upper level of the home, Capt. Mercer said. The county coroner’s office said determinations about the cause and manner of her death were pending.
A state police fire marshal was investigating. Responders at the scene included, in addition to the city fire department, firefighters from the Canton, North Strabane and South Strabane fire departments as well as Ambulance and Chair Emergency Medical Services.
